Share count rising — dilution

+49.2% over 4y

The company has issued more shares over this period, which dilutes each existing shareholder’s stake.

Diluted shares outstanding: 48.2M (2021) → 71.9M (2025)

Office Properties Income Trust is a national REIT focused on owning and leasing office properties to high credit quality tenants in markets throughout the United States. As of June 30, 2025, approximately 59% of OPI revenues were from investment grade rated tenants. OPI owned 125 properties as of June 30, 2025, with approximately 17.3 million square feet located in 29 states and Washington, D.C. In 2024, OPI was named as an Energy Star Partner of the Year for the seventh consecutive year. OPI is managed by The RMR Group, a leading U.S. alternative asset management company with approximately 40 billion dollars in assets under management as of June 30, 2025, and more than 35 years of institutional experience in buying, selling, financing and operating commercial real estate. OPI is headquarters in Newton, MA. On October 30, 2025, Office Properties Income Trust, along with its affiliates, filed a voluntary petition for reorganization under Chapter 11 in the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of Texas. Office Properties Income Trust is incorporated in 2009 in Newton, Maryland.
